I am looking for the chart that shows the one day low mean temperature across the US. This chart is used to determine
the MDMT for pressure vessel design. I can visualize the chart but I don't know where I last saw it. It kind of looks like the wind charts in the ASCE standards.
Can anyone refresh my memory as to where this chart is?

It is indeed the API650 as chandljm noted above, the 11th ed. 2007, Fig.4-2.

In ASME VIII, the MDMT is eastablished based upon process conditions, not necessarily by weather-related data. I don't think the API-650 charts should be the sole basis for pressure vessel service. Vesssels are much smaller and may react more quickly to atmosphereic changes. The thinking is different for a storage tank. It gives good data for average daily temps at at your site. AWWA D100 has a newer version of the same chart. So does NFPA-22
